Baumann, Cecilia C. – Bulletin of the Association of Departments of Foreign Languages, 1979
This article suggests utilizing three important international resources available on college campuses: international students, faculty members with international experience, and community resources. Suggestions are given for intergrating these resources into the foreign language program. (CFM)

Schug, Mark C. – Social Studies, 1983
A rationale and framework for community-based teacher education using social studies as an example is developed. The framework includes three types of community involvement: community service programs, community-based courses and workshops, and internships or experiential programs. (RM)

Caldwell, Jo Ann – Social Studies Review, 1984
The Young Historians project provides abundant opportunities for students in grades one through six to apply basic reading, writing, listening, speaking, and computing skills learned during reading and math and to learn firsthand about their own heritage and the many resources in their own community.
